Ingredients
  

1 cup creamy peanut butter

1 cup powdered sugar

1 cup crushed Butterfinger candy bars (about 5 bars)

1 teaspoon vanilla extract

2 cups milk chocolate chips

1 tablespoon coconut oil (optional, for a smoother melt)

Instructions
 

Prepare the Mixture: In a mixing bowl, combine the creamy peanut butter, powdered sugar, crushed Butterfinger candy bars, and vanilla extract. Mix until everything is well incorporated and a sticky dough forms.

    Form the Balls: Using your hands, scoop out about 1 tablespoon of the mixture and roll it into a ball. Place it on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Repeat until all the mixture is used, spacing the balls about an inch apart.

      Chill the Balls: Place the baking sheet in the refrigerator for about an hour to allow the balls to firm up.

        Melt the Chocolate: In a microwave-safe bowl, combine the milk chocolate chips and coconut oil.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ring in between until smooth and fully melted.

          Dip the Balls: Remove the chilled peanut butter balls from the refrigerator. Using a fork or toothpick, dip each ball into the melted chocolate, making sure it is fully coated. Allow any excess chocolate to drip off.

            Set the Chocolate: Return the chocolate-coated balls to the parchment-lined baking sheet. If desired, sprinkle a little crushed Butterfinger on top for decoration before the chocolate sets.

              Cool and Serve: Refrigerate the chocolate-covered balls for about 30 minutes, or until the chocolate hardens completely. Serve chilled and enjoy your sweet treat!

                Prep Time: 15 minutes | Total Time: 1 hour 30 minutes | Servings: 20-24 balls
